Also new from Meguiar’s and another newcomer to their Hybrid Ceramic lineup is called Pre-Wax Prep and shares the same pleasing smell as the exterior trim product although the bottle is a different colour here (bright red).

It is super easy to apply and is almost a wipe on; wipe off type elixir that does remove swirl marks and helped revive some tired-looking paint on my friend’s 20-year-old Jaguar XJ, which due to a gearbox problem has been parked up for several months, meaning the paint has been neglected.

After shampooing the car, this stuff got to work very quickly and it was soon ready for the sealant and wax stages. I initially thought it expensive at £20 but once I tried it out and saw how it worked, I now believe it to be a very good product and if you follow a detailing regime involving multiple stages then this will be of real interest.
